Title: | Funny little objects |
Authors: | Jackson, Lucy |
Publisher: | INZART / The University of Auckland Library = Te Tumu Herenga |
Abstract: | Article speaks to the painting practice of artist Emily Hartley-Skudder, in which she captures the space between public and private, artificial and real. Discusses 2017 works 'Soft Staging' and 'Fourth Wall', and new paintings 'Blue Rinse', 'Shy Rose Next Door' and 'Tomboy Avocado'. |
